09-19-2008, 02:45 PM
Justin,
When you sent your print did you put a Customs Sticker on the outside of the package saying it had no commercial value? That happened to me when I sent a print to Italy and forgot to put a sticker on the outside. You have to have that notice for customs otherwise your print might be delayed in their office forever! I have sent prints all over the world and that one to Italy was the only one that never made it to its destination.
